Stephanie Miller is an American political commentator, comedian, and host of "The Stephanie Miller Show," a progressive talk radio program. Known for her sharp wit and insightful commentary, she has become a prominent voice in political media.
Stephanie Miller was born on September 29, 1961, in Washington, D.C. She is the daughter of former U.S. Representative William E. Miller, who was Barry Goldwater's running mate in the 1964 presidential election. She grew up in a politically active household, which influenced her career in political commentary.
Stephanie Miller is openly lesbian and has been a vocal advocate for LGBTQ+ rights. She often discusses her personal experiences and the importance of equality and acceptance on her show.
Stephanie Miller began her career in radio and television, eventually becoming the host of "The Stephanie Miller Show." Her program has garnered a significant following for its humorous yet incisive take on current events and politics. She has also performed stand-up comedy and appeared on various television shows.
Stephanie Miller has received multiple awards for her work in radio, including Talkers Magazine's "Woman of the Year" award. Her show has also been ranked among the top talk radio programs in the United States.
